“…An external stimulus causes the pitch to expand or contract, resulting in the corresponding shift of the reflection band. Due to the high proportion of non‐reactive components (50–80 wt.%), [ 17,20 ] the polymerized porous film exhibits large pores and strong light scattering. In this case, the high porosity of the film may limit its robustness.…”
